RE: Diff Oil
Depends on the person and the track that you run on. Some people buy the expensive dif and love it on a certain track and on others they run regulars. If you feel like spending that much on a differencial go for it but you could save for another motor, new servos, new radio, new pipe or many other things.
The standard setup for gear difs in a 1/8 scale buggy is 5k front, 7k middle and 1k rear. Steve |

RE: Diff Oil
Oil weight you choose is completely up to you. I personally use 50k - 100k - 30k. It's almost like having a solid shaft but not quite. I am leaning towards putting a solid shaft in the center in place of the diff just because I am not into different brake settings for the front and rear, I want the most power out of the engine to hit the wheels.
